一、服务器类型与网站空间分类
现代网站空间主要包含四种服务形态:共享主机、虚拟专用服务器(VPS)、独立服务器和云服务器。其中VPS通过虚拟化技术将物理服务器分割为多个独立虚拟机,适合中型网站需求。云服务器基于分布式架构实现资源池化,具备弹性伸缩能力,可动态调整计算资源。
二、VPS的核心特性与技术实现
VPS的核心优势体现在资源隔离与灵活扩展性:
- 采用KVM/VMware等虚拟化技术实现硬件资源抽象化
- 支持独立操作系统部署与动态资源配置
- 提供远程桌面级管理权限,操作体验接近物理服务器
典型应用场景包括:开发测试环境搭建、中小型网站部署及数据库服务等。
三、弹性伸缩机制的技术解析
云服务器的弹性伸缩包含以下技术流程:
- 实时监控CPU/内存等资源指标
- 触发预设扩缩容策略(水平/垂直伸缩)
- 自动创建/销毁实例并与负载均衡器联动
- 资源回收与成本优化
该机制在电商大促、在线教育等流量波动场景中,可提升50%以上的资源利用率。
四、资源管理策略与实践
有效的资源管理需结合服务类型制定策略:
类型 | 扩展方式 | 管理重点 |
---|---|---|
VPS | 手动配置升级 | 进程监控与隔离 |
云服务器 | 自动弹性伸缩 | 策略优化与成本控制 |
建议采用混合架构:核心业务使用VPS保证稳定性,前端服务通过云服务器实现自动扩缩容。
VPS与弹性伸缩技术共同构建了现代网站空间的资源管理体系。VPS在资源隔离和成本控制方面具有优势,而云服务器的弹性伸缩机制则解决了动态资源分配难题。技术选型需综合考虑业务规模、流量特征和运维能力。